Kate Kindersley founded Hadeda, a unique home collection sourced from artisans across fashion, ceramics, art, weaving, beading and carpentry from Africa and around the globe. Kate grew up between Africa and the UK. The business is informed by a belief in the enduring value of craft and design over mass production.
In this episode Kate and Sophie discuss heartbreak pizza, the power of a roast and imagine a world where you only ate Greek yoghurt!
